Tuesday Tales: The Plot Thickens

2/8/2015

8 Comments

 
Picture
The romantic dinner Will & Tonya didn't have.
Her two fingers exerted a moderate bit of pressure until the hood popped with a click. It didn’t fly open, but it did unlatch. So simple, even Clint could do it. Forget Peeping Tom, the man sabotaged her car. Now, she’d have to clean out her garage tonight.

“Now, you’ve learned something.” Will’s voice took on a suggestive turn as he spoke into her ear.

Yeah, she learned something, all right. Locking the car, blocking his calls still left her vulnerable. Her fingers remained under the hood rim as she angled her head to reply. The whisper soft kiss surprised her. Two teenage boys hooting nearby tainted the moment. “Work it.”

The catcall had Will backing away. “Sorry. Not the best place to kiss you. I couldn’t help myself.” His lips tilted up with his excuse.

 Stupid boys ruined the moment. Why did she care what they thought? Hands free of the hood, she stepped toward Will wrapping her arms around his neck. “There’s never a bad place.” She rocked forward on her toes to reach his lips, ignoring the loud remarks from across the parking lot.

 His lips followed hers with a sensual leisure that melted any remaining resistance. What was the reason they shouldn’t get involved. One of the teens, probably egged on by the other, yelled, “Get a room.”

 The thought had merit. Whoa, girl.

 She allowed her heels to drop breaking the kiss. His hot gaze threatened to set her ablaze. The expected kiss didn’t come. Instead, he stepped back, as a slow wicked smile grew.

 “Start your car. If it catches I’ll follow you home to make sure it’s okay.”

 Her eyes remained on his face until he winked. Oh yeah, follow me home.
